Wavy hair typically has an S &#8211; shaped pattern, with varying degrees of curl. It can range from loose, beachy waves to more defined, tighter waves. The texture of wavy hair can also differ, being fine, medium, or coarse.<\/p>\n<p>The structure of wavy hair is different from straight hair. The cuticles of wavy hair are often more raised, which can make it more prone to frizz and damage. Additionally, the natural wave pattern is a result of the shape of the hair follicles. When considering using a hair straightener, these factors need to be taken into account.<\/p>\n<h3>Can You Use a Hair Straightener on Wavy Hair?<\/h3>\n<p>The short answer is yes, you can use a hair straightener on wavy hair. Hair straighteners work by applying heat to the hair, which breaks the hydrogen bonds in the hair shaft. Once these bonds are broken, the hair can be reshaped into a straighter form. However, there are several factors to consider before reaching for your straightener.<\/p>\n<h4>Hair Health<\/h4>\n<p>The health of your wavy hair is crucial. If your hair is already damaged, dry, or brittle, using a hair straightener can exacerbate the problem. Heat from the straightener can cause further damage, leading to split ends, breakage, and a loss of shine. Before using a straightener, it&#8217;s advisable to assess the condition of your hair. If it&#8217;s in poor condition, it may be better to focus on hair repair and conditioning before attempting to straighten it.<\/p>\n<h4>Heat Setting<\/h4>\n<p>Most hair straighteners come with adjustable heat settings. When using a straightener on wavy hair, it&#8217;s important to choose the right heat setting. Lower heat settings are generally better for fine or damaged wavy hair, as they reduce the risk of heat damage. Coarser or thicker wavy hair may require a higher heat setting, but it&#8217;s still important not to go too high. A good rule of thumb is to start with a lower heat setting and gradually increase it if necessary.<\/p>\n<h4>Protectant Products<\/h4>\n<p>Using a heat protectant product is essential when using a hair straightener on wavy hair. Heat protectants create a barrier between the hair and the hot plates of the straightener, reducing the amount of damage caused by the heat. There are various types of heat protectants available, including sprays, creams, and serums. Look for products that are specifically formulated for heat styling and contain ingredients like silicone, which can help to smooth the hair and protect it from heat.<\/p>\n<h3>Benefits of Using a Hair Straightener on Wavy Hair<\/h3>\n<p>There are several benefits to using a hair straightener on wavy hair.<\/p>\n<h4>Versatility<\/h4>\n<p>One of the main advantages is the increased styling versatility. By straightening your wavy hair, you can change your look from a curly or wavy style to a sleek, straight look. This allows you to switch up your appearance depending on the occasion. For example, you might want to wear your hair straight for a formal event or a job interview, while keeping your natural waves for a more casual look.<\/p>\n<h4>Reduced Frizz<\/h4>\n<p>Wavy hair is often prone to frizz, especially in humid conditions. Straightening your wavy hair can help to reduce frizz and create a smoother, more polished look. The heat from the straightener can seal the cuticles of the hair, preventing moisture from getting in and causing frizz.<\/p>\n<h4>Easier Styling<\/h4>\n<p>Straight hair can be easier to style in some cases. It may be quicker to brush, comb, and style straight hair compared to wavy hair. This can be a time &#8211; saver, especially on busy days.<\/p>\n<h3>Considerations and Precautions<\/h3>\n<p>While using a hair straightener on wavy hair can be beneficial, there are also some considerations and precautions to keep in mind.<\/p>\n<h4>Frequency of Use<\/h4>\n<p>Overusing a hair straightener can cause significant damage to your wavy hair. It&#8217;s recommended to limit the use of a straightener to a few times a week. If you straighten your hair every day, you&#8217;re more likely to experience heat damage, such as dryness, breakage, and split ends.<\/p>\n<h4>Proper Technique<\/h4>\n<p>Using the straightener correctly is crucial. When straightening your wavy hair, start from the roots and work your way down to the ends. Use slow, steady strokes and avoid pulling or tugging on the hair. It&#8217;s also important to section your hair to ensure that each section is evenly straightened.<\/p>\n<h4>After &#8211; Care<\/h4>\n<p>After straightening your wavy hair, it&#8217;s important to take good care of it. Use a moisturizing shampoo and conditioner to keep your hair hydrated. You can also use hair masks or deep &#8211; conditioning treatments regularly to repair any damage caused by the heat.
